5.0 out of 5 stars Excellent Study Aid, August 25, 2008
This review is from: Police Sergeant, Lieutenant, and Captain Promotion Exams (Paperback)
This book is an excellent companion to your study material. The hints they give you are for the "buzz-words" that civil service examiners love to use in test questions. They certainly don't guarantee a correct answer, but when you're stuck, knowing those key words and/or phrases can bail you out. The practice exams in this book are more than worth the price of purchase. This book definitely helped me with my promotion exam.

5.0 out of 5 stars Not the be all and end all, but a part of a complete study diet, October 14, 2008
By 
Ant (Long Island, NY USA) - See all my reviews
Amazon Verified Purchase(What's this?)
This review is from: Police Sergeant, Lieutenant, and Captain Promotion Exams (Paperback)
First, I'd like to give the disclaimer that I've only taken promotion exams in NY. This book is good for NY police promotional exams, as it goes over a lot of reading interpretation and Iannone concepts, but if you're outside of NY, caveat emptor.

One of the authors of this book runs prep courses in NY. Going over this book (which of course he listed as suggested reading in his course :-)) and looking at his course material, I can say that the book is the Reader's Digest version of parts of his course. I'm purposefully being vague because I don't want it to seem that I'm advertising for them, but that course, along with his lectures and classes, hitting Iannone's book hard, assorted NYS law books, and then using this book as a quick question bank/refresher guide helped me greatly. Even though I recommend it (especially if your jurisdiction uses Iannone's "Supervision of Police Personnel" for exam material) don't rely just on this one book though, devour as much info as you can. It's your career, why skimp on it?

2.0 out of 5 stars Don't waste your money, September 7, 2007
By 
T Ski (madison, WI) - See all my reviews
This review is from: Police Sergeant, Lieutenant, and Captain Promotion Exams (Paperback)
I purchased this book on recommendation from a Promotional Preparation course I recently attended. It is horrible! It isn't worth the time or money to read. It basically tells you how to cheat on written exams by looking for certain words in the questions and answers. If you honestly read the material you are supposed to and take your written exam you will do much better than to try the tactics this book suggests.
